Fit data
Numbers for sizing and ride feel.
| Size | SM | MD | LG | XL |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Stack Reach Ratio | 1.42 mm | 1.36 mm | 1.3 mm | 1.22 mm |
| Bottom Bracket Height | 340 mm | 340 mm | 340 mm | 340 mm |
| Front Center | 701 mm | 730 mm | 757 mm | 794 mm |
| Rake | 51 mm | 51 mm | 51 mm | 51 mm |
| Trail | 100 mm | 100 mm | 100 mm | 100 mm |
| Stack | 595 mm | 604 mm | 609 mm | 614 mm |
| Reach | 419 mm | 444 mm | 469 mm | 504 mm |
| Top Tube Length | 577 mm | 605 mm | 631 mm | 667 mm |
| Seat Tube Angle | 75 ° | 75 ° | 75 ° | 75 ° |
| Seat Tube Length | 370 mm | 420 mm | 470 mm | 530 mm |
| Head Tube Angle | 67.5 ° | 67.5 ° | 67.5 ° | 67.5 ° |
| Head Tube Length | 90 mm | 100 mm | 105 mm | 110 mm |
| Chainstay Length | 434 mm | 434 mm | 434 mm | 434 mm |
| Wheelbase | 1133 mm | 1162 mm | 1189 mm | 1226 mm |
| Bottom Bracket Drop | 35 mm | 35 mm | 35 mm | 35 mm |
| Standover Height | 745 mm | 745 mm | 745 mm | 745 mm |
| Wheels | 29" | 29" | 29" | 29" |
| Rider Min Height | 152 cm | 157 cm | 175 cm | 180 cm |
| Rider Max Height | 170 cm | 182 cm | 195 cm | 195 cm |

Overview of components
Fork
Kona Hei Hei CR 2021 bike is equipped with the Fox Performance Float 34 fork, and has 120mm travel. Bike forks are perfect to absorb shocks and provide a great riding experience overall. In conclusion, always look for a fork with decent travel when you buy a bike.
Rear Shock
The shock that’s installed on this bike is Fox Float DPS Evol Performance, with a travel distance of 120mm. Rear shocks improve riding comfort and give you greater control over all terrains. To sum up, get a full-suspension bike if you want the smoothest rides.
Wheels size
The Hei Hei CR 2021 bike is equipped with 29″ aluminum wheels when leaving the factory. These wheels are more forgiving when you go over roots, rocks, bumps, or other obstacles you encounter on your ride. However, 29″ wheels will make your bike react slower to obstacles you may encounter.
